Nebraska's Foster Care System: A Guide for Families

Navigating Nebraska's foster care system can feel overwhelming, but understanding the process and available resources can make a real difference. If you're exploring becoming a foster parent, this guide will provide helpful information to get you started.

First and foremost, it's important to know the various types of foster care available in Nebraska. These include short-term placements, respite care, and specialized care for children with individual needs. Each type of placement offers different levels of commitment.

Becoming a foster parent is a life-changing experience that requires patience. By learning more, you can make an meaningful impact on the lives of children in need.
